Physical Therapist Assistants, under the direction and supervision of a physical therapist, assist with specific components of treatment interventions. Their duties may include a variety of interventions including therapeutic exercises, functional training in both self-care, sports, and work reintegration, use of adaptive equipment, wound management, airway clearance, and the use of bio-physical agents. They attain their requisite skills through extensive academic and clinical education.
